PCB Chairman blamed Imran Khan for embarrassing group-stage exit in Champions Trophy

PCB Chairman blamed Imran Khan for embarrassing group-stage exit in Champions Trophy

Najam Sethi, the former chairman of the Pakistan Cricket Board (PCB), attacks on the Imran Khan. He blamed that Imran Khan is responsible for national team’s downfall and their embarrassing group-stage exit in the Champions Trophy. The host country and defending champions face a humiliating fate after losing their opening two Group A matches last week. Why PCB Chairman blame Imran Khan

 PCB Chairman Sethi blames the Imran Khan for not justifying with nation. Sethi reckoned the downslide starts in 2019 when PCB management brought in, head by Ehsan Mani, under then PM Imran. The cricket fraternity says that Pakistan hit rock bottom. How come a cricket team that was once no 1 in T20s (2018) and Tests (2016) and ODIs (1990 and 1996), that won WC in 1992 and CT in 2017, equated today with Zimbabwe?”

With this change in the age-old domestic cricket structure, political interference and contradictory policies become a big part in going hassles for the Pakistan team.

National team downfall starts in 2019

After the PCB chairman angry with Imran Khan, fans questioned over the downfall era. The downfall began in 2019 when new management under a new PM/Patron changed the domestic cricket structure. It replaced it with an ill-suited Australian hybrid model. Political interference cause; contradictory PCB policies became the norm— foreign coaches were hired and sent packing, and selectors were nominated. Old discards were placed to guide and manage. Finally, clash of captain egos, player power, groupings in the team came results in fumbling management. It causes horrible results,” he said.
